Generic tracker of items, based on a simple history queue (get last, get next) model.
Typically, such objects are long-lived; internally, references to items are strong. Therefore, it is up to the user to make sure that referenced objects are not prevented from being garbage collected, should they be.

ItemHistory
public ItemHistory(int capacity, boolean cleanHistoryAfterIndex) Create a history object with the- Parameters:
capacity
- maximum capacity, must be at least 1cleanHistoryAfterIndex
- if true, recording an element into the history when the history index is not at the top will erase all elements after the index and add the new item at the top; if false, the item is inserted at the top regardless of where the history index was
